Audio dropouts and glitches can significantly impact the quality of sound, resulting in disruptions that interrupt the listener’s experience. These issues manifest as brief silences, unexpected noise, or distortions in the audio stream. Understanding the underlying causes is essential for both professionals and consumers aiming to maintain high-quality audio performance.
Hardware limitations often contribute to audio dropouts. Sound systems have to process data in real-time, and when the hardware is unable to keep up with the demands of the audio workload, glitches occur. This can be due to insufficient processing power, outdated audio drivers, or incompatible sound cards. Additionally, overburdened system resources from running multiple applications can strain the audio processing capabilities of a device.
On the software side, audio glitches can result from problems within the digital audio software itself. Incorrect settings, software conflicts, or bugs can all disrupt the audio signal. Network issues, such as inadequate bandwidth or high latency, also affect the transmission of audio streams, particularly in online communications or when streaming content. By examining these components and their interactions, one can identify and mitigate the reasons for audio disruptions.
Understanding Audio System Fundamentals
To effectively diagnose audio dropouts and glitches, one must grasp the key elements of an audio system and understand the role of digital processing.
Components of an Audio System
An audio system consists of various hardware and software components that work together to produce and manipulate sound. The audio interface is a pivotal piece of hardware that serves as a bridge between analog and digital domains, connecting microphones and instruments to a computer. It often includes preamps, converters, and headphone outputs.
- Operating System (OS): The software platform that manages hardware resources and provides services for computer programs.
- CPU (Central Processing Unit): The primary component that executes instructions from various software processes.
- RAM (Random Access Memory): Volatile memory that provides space for the operating system and applications to store and access data quickly.
- Drivers: Software components that enable the OS to communicate with and control hardware devices.
An optimized audio system ensures seamless data flow between these elements, which is vital to preventing audio glitches. When there are issues with any of these components, they can cause disruptions in audio processing.
Digital Audio Processing Basics
Digital audio processing involves the conversion and manipulation of audio signals within a computer environment. An important concept in this process is the audio buffer, which temporarily stores audio data before it’s processed by the CPU. The buffer size, which is adjustable via the audio interface’s drivers, impacts latency and processing load; a balance is essential for system stability.
- ASIO (Audio Stream Input/Output): A protocol for low-latency digital audio specified by Steinberg, providing a direct path between the software application and the audio hardware.
- Latency: The delay between an audio input being processed and the corresponding output.
Drivers, particularly ASIO for Windows users, ensure a more efficient data stream by allowing the software to communicate directly with the audio interface, often resulting in lower latency. The CPU’s role is to execute digital signal processing tasks quickly, while sufficient RAM is necessary to handle the temporary data during this process. Ensuring the operating system and drivers are stable and up-to-date is crucial to the system’s overall performance. When these are misaligned, it can lead to audio glitches and dropouts.
Common Causes of Audio Dropouts and Glitches
Audio dropouts and glitches often occur due to a combination of factors that impact the quality and continuity of audio playback or recording. Identifying these issues can help in troubleshooting and resolving audio problems.
Hardware Resource Limitations
Audio processing is demanding on system resources. When a computer lacks sufficient processing power or RAM, this can lead to audio dropouts. Specifically, high CPU usage from other processes reduces the resources available for audio tasks, which can cause glitches.
- CPU: High latency if CPU is overwhelmed
- RAM: Insufficient memory increases the risk of dropouts
Inadequate Buffer Settings
The buffer size affects audio latency and performance. Small buffers reduce latency but can cause dropouts if the system can’t process audio quickly enough. Conversely, large buffers reduce the risk of dropouts but increase latency.
- Low buffer size: May lead to glitches during high CPU usage
- High buffer size: Can cause noticeable delay in audio processing
Faulty or Improper Cabling
Cables are physical links between audio devices. Faulty, damaged, or low-quality cables can introduce noise, intermittency, or complete signal loss, leading to glitches and dropouts.
- Damaged cables: Can interrupt the audio signal
- Incorrect cables: May not support required bandwidth or specifications
Software and Driver Conflicts
Audio dropouts can also stem from software issues or driver conflicts. Outdated or incompatible drivers may not communicate effectively with the operating system or audio hardware, causing interruptions.
- Outdated drivers: Can lead to incompatibility and functional issues
- Software conflicts: May cause the system to prioritize other processes over audio, resulting in dropouts
An understanding of how these factors can cause audio dropouts and glitches is crucial for diagnosing and fixing audio issues efficiently.
Diagnosing and Troubleshooting Techniques
Accurate diagnosis is critical in rectifying audio dropouts and glitches. The following techniques involve systematic approaches to identify and rectify the root cause of audio issues.
Utilizing Audio Analyzers and Diagnostic Tools
Audio analyzers serve as a vital resource in pinpointing the origin of audio issues. They measure signal integrity and isolate distortion or interference. Technicians should use these tools to capture real-time data, which facilitates identifying irregularities in audio output. Diagnostic software, like DAW-specific utilities, can help monitor system performance and detect latency problems. When troubleshooting, it’s beneficial to compare findings against known good benchmarks to assess audio quality.
- Analyze signal integrity
- Identify distortion or interference
- Monitor system performance
Updating and Configuring Software
Continuous software updates ensure compatibility and performance. Users should regularly check for Windows updates and update audio drivers to avoid compatibility issues that may manifest as audio glitches. Proper configuration of audio settings within the operating system or software application is also essential to prevent conflicts that can lead to audio dropouts.
- Check and apply Windows updates
- Update audio driver software
- Reconfigure audio settings as needed
Hardware Maintenance and Upgrades
Consistent hardware maintenance is essential for reliable audio reproduction. Users should clean audio equipment to remove dust and debris that can cause static or interference. Additionally, upgrading outdated components such as sound cards or interfaces can resolve issues due to hardware limitations or failures. When servicing hardware, always power down and disconnect devices to ensure safety and prevent further problems.
- Perform regular cleaning and dusting
- Upgrade outdated audio components
- Service equipment safely with proper power-down procedures
Best Practices for Preventing Audio Problems
To maintain high-quality audio production, it is essential to understand and implement effective strategies for system optimization and resource management.
Optimizing System Settings
System settings play a critical role in optimizing audio performance. Users should ensure that their audio interface is correctly configured for the lowest possible audio latency without sacrificing system stability. Adjusting buffer sizes and sample rates through the audio software or dedicated control panel can significantly reduce latency issues. Monitoring DPC latency—the delay of Deferred Procedure Calls which can affect audio streaming—helps in identifying system components that may cause glitches.
Strategic Use of USB Hubs and Ports
Not all USB ports are equal. Devices benefit from a strategic approach to connecting audio interfaces and other peripherals. Audio professionals recommend:
- Using USB hubs with independent power sources to prevent power fluctuations and maintain a steady data flow.
- Connecting audio interfaces directly to high-speed USB ports on the computer rather than through a hub to minimize latency.
- Ensuring that USB hubs used for audio purposes are well shielded to reduce the risk of signal interference that can lead to audio glitches.
Effective Management of Audio Plug-ins
Audio plug-ins are powerful tools but can also be sources of audio problems if not managed correctly. They recommend:
- Regularly updating plug-ins to their latest versions for improved efficiency and stability.
- Using only essential plug-ins during a session to lighten CPU load, therefore preventing undue strain that can cause audio dropouts.
- Utilizing glitch detection tools to monitor plug-ins performance and remove or replace those that frequently cause issues.
By following these best practices, users can expect a noticeable improvement in their audio workflow, reducing the risk of encountering disruptive audio dropouts and glitches.